Abstract :
Products of the gas-phase reactions of OH radicals (in the presence of NO) and O3 with the biogenic emission cis-3-hexen-1-ol have been investigated using gas chromatography with flame ionization detection (GC-FID), combined gas chromatography-mass spectrometry (GC-MS), gas chromatography with Fourier transform infrared spectroscopy (GC-FTIR), and direct air sampling, atmospheric pressure ionization tandem mass spectrometry (API-MS). Propanal and 3-hydroxypropanal were identified and quantified from the OH radical and O3 radical reactions, with respective formation yields of 0.746 ± 0.067 and 0.48−0.24+0.48 from the OH radical reaction and 0.493 ± 0.075 and 0.33−0.16+0.33 from the O3 reaction. In addition, a hydroxynitrate of molecular weight 179 [CH3CH2CH(OH)CH(ONO2)CH2CH2OH and/or CH3CH2CH(ONO2)CH(OH)CH2CH2OH] and a hydroxycarbonyl of molecular weight 132, expected to be CH3CH2CH(OH)CH(OH)CH2CHO, were observed from the OH radical reaction by API-MS analyses. The reaction mechanisms are discussed.
